Skip to main content

GTA Online ha caricamenti lentissimi? Un modder li velocizza del 70%

Ecco come ci è riuscito.

A quanto pare, un modder di GTA Online è stato in grado di ridurre i tempi di caricamento fino al 70% e ha offerto la soluzione ai giocatori che desiderano ridurre anche i propri tempi di caricamento.

Il modder T0ST ha pubblicato un articolo che analizza i tempi di caricamento spaventosi in GTA Online. Dopo aver fatto alcune ricerche e scritto un programma unico per interagire con i file di gioco, T0ST è riuscito a ridurre i tempi di caricamento fino al 70%. Si scopre così che il gioco non ha necessariamente difficoltà a caricarsi grazie alla sua natura open world, ma questo rallentamento è dato da un collo di bottiglia della CPU che fatica ad analizzare un file JSON da 10 MB che il gioco deve leggere per aprirsi correttamente. Questo database contiene ben 63.000 oggetti e viene setacciato ogni volta che il gioco si apre.

Quel che è peggio, una volta che il file JSON "mal costruito" è stato letto, anche la routine di deduplicazione degli elementi di Rockstar funziona in maniera lenta. T0ST è stato in grado di scrivere un file .dll che può essere importato nel file GTA Online e utilizzato per migliorare i tempi di caricamento di un margine significativo.

Il file contiene una libreria di funzioni e altre informazioni a cui è possibile accedere da un programma Windows per una più facile comprensione e analisi. Creando questo nuovo file .dll (e rendendolo disponibile per il download pubblico), T0ST ha essenzialmente reso disponibili a tutti i miglioramenti del tempo di caricamento che è riuscito a creare nel proprio gioco.

Nella ricerca preliminare di T0ST, il modder ha scoperto che oltre l'80% degli utenti si è lamentato di un tempo di caricamento di 3-6 minuti durante l'avvio di GTA Online, con oltre il 35% che deve aspettare sei o più minuti per entrare nel gioco. Il modder ha invitato Rockstar a risolvere questo problema visto che non dovrebbe essere così difficile da affrontare. Non ci resta che aspettare e vedere se Rockstar accetterà il suggerimento del giocatore.

Fonte: Eurogamer